What it is and where the VH series sits
The JST B7P-VH(LF)(SN) is the 7-circuit member of the VH family — a single-row board-to-cable header with a 1-wall shroud and a locking ramp that mechanically latches into the matching VH plug housing to resist vibration-assisted decoupling. The series targets power-distribution and signal-harness applications in industrial equipment where a positively-latching wire-connector interface outranks the density of a bare unshrouded pin strip.
Ratings that govern the BOM fit
At 10 A per contact and 250 V the B7P-VH(LF)(SN) covers low-level power taps such as actuator feeds and LED drivers without requiring a dedicated power connector. The 0.156 inch (3.96 mm) pitch provides wider spacing that reduces flashover risk at 250 V and gives fingers more room during in-field termination. Tin plating on both the mating face and the solder post is standard for this series — no gold option is listed on this member. For high-cycle reconnection duty the tin finish will oxidize faster than gold, but for permanent or low-cycle harness installs (the typical board-to-cable use case) the plating grade is adequate. Brass substrate carries the current without the magnetic permeability concerns of steel under high current pulses.
Shrouding and locking ramp
The single-wall shroud guides the plug housing into the header and the locking ramp snaps the pair together — the audible click confirms the latch is seated before the harness ships. Without the shroud a pin strip is fully exposed; with it the VH header survives the cable-pull loads and incidental side-loading that would back a bare header out of the PCB hole.
Board-level fit
Through-hole mounting with a 0.146 inch (3.70 mm) post length and 0.575 inch (14.60 mm) overall contact length gives reasonable stand-off above the board for cleaning under the header after wave solder. The 0.370 inch (9.40 mm) insulation height and 16.5 mm mated stacking height define the header's z-profile in the assembly — relevant if the enclosure or daughter-card cage constrains the header envelope. The housing material is polyamide (PA66) rated UL94 V-0, so the connector can be specified inside equipment that requires flame-retardant enclosure plastics.
Lifecycle and sourcing posture
The B7P-VH(LF)(SN) carries an Active product status and RoHS Compliant designation — no end-of-life notice, no last-time-buy date, and no official successor is listed. The non-lead-free twin B7P-VH shares the same 7-position footprint, pitch, current, and voltage ratings and drops into the same PCB land pattern; the only difference is the lead-free plating code in the order string.
